Understanding HVAC in Roseville: Climate, Comfort, and Cost Dynamics
Roseville’s Mediterranean climate brings hot, dry summers and cool, wet winters. Those swings make HVAC systems work hard during peak seasons, and they shape how you should plan maintenance and budgeting.
Summer: Highs frequently push 95–105°F. Efficient air conditioning is non-negotiable. Systems see sustained load, so minor issues (refrigerant leaks, dirty coils) become major problems fast.
Fall: The best time for HVAC maintenance before heating season. Also ideal for evaluating whether air conditioning replacement should happen before next summer’s demand spike.
Winter: Nighttime lows in the 30s and 40s demand reliable furnaces or heat pumps. Furnace repair becomes an in-season necessity if ignition or airflow issues arise.
Spring: Peak allergy season with pollen and, some years, wildfire smoke. Filtration and indoor air quality upgrades shine here.
Cost-wise, electricity rates and natural gas prices influence total operating cost across the year. Efficient systems—combined with a dialed-in thermostat strategy—save serious money over time. How to Identify Common HVAC Problems Before They Escalate
Early detection is money in the bank. Here’s what to watch for—and what each symptom might mean.
AC blowing warm air
Possible causes: Low refrigerant, dirty condenser coil, failed compressor contactor, clogged air filter.
What to try: Check and replace filter, verify thermostat mode and settings, ensure outdoor unit is clear of debris.
Short cycling (system turns on and off rapidly)
Possible causes: Oversized unit, restricted airflow, faulty thermostat, frozen evaporator coil.
What to try: Replace filter, check vents are open, observe the evaporator coil for frost if accessible and safe.

Furnace won’t ignite
Possible causes: Faulty ignitor, dirty flame sensor, closed gas valve, tripped safety switch.
What to try: Verify thermostat call for heat, check breaker, ensure the furnace door is secured (safety switch), call for service for gas-related issues.
Safety first: If you smell gas, hear persistent hissing near gas lines, or suspect a cracked heat exchanger, shut off the system, ventilate the home, https://s3.us-east-1.amazonaws.com/all-1-mechanical/heating-and-cooling-services-roseville-ca/hvac/furnace-repair-services-in-roseville-protect-your-comfort.html and contact a licensed HVAC Contractor immediately.
Repair vs. Replacement: A Clear, Practical Framework
Not sure whether to repair or replace your AC or furnace? Use this framework to reduce guesswork.
Age of equipment
AC: 10–15 years typical lifespan in Roseville. If yours is past 12 and needs a major component, consider replacement.
Furnace: 15–20 years typical. If over 15 with heat exchanger or control board issues, evaluate replacement options.
Repair cost threshold
The 50% rule: If a repair is half the cost of a comparable new unit, replacement usually makes more sense.
The $5,000 rule of thumb: Multiply unit age by repair cost. If the total exceeds $5,000, consider replacement.
Efficiency gap
Older systems often run at lower SEER/EER (AC) or AFUE (furnace). Upgrading can reduce utility bills 15–30%+.
Reliability and comfort
Frequent breakdowns, poor humidity control, or uneven temperatures hint the system is no longer a good fit.
Incentives and rebates
California and utility programs often offer rebates for high-efficiency HVAC installation, heat pumps, and smart thermostats. These can tilt the math toward replacement.

Air Conditioning Repair vs. Air Conditioning Replacement: Making the Smart Choice
Let’s tackle a frequent homeowner crossroads.
Choose air conditioning repair when:
The unit is under 10 years old.
The issue is minor: capacitor, contactor, clogged drain, weak thermostat, dirty coils.
Your system performance has been reliable historically.
Consider air conditioning replacement when:
The compressor fails on a unit over 10–12 years old.
You have an R-22 system (older refrigerant), and repairs are costly or refrigerant is scarce.
You face repeated repairs every summer or poor cooling across zones.
Your energy bills are steadily rising despite maintenance.
Don’t forget comfort features:
Variable-speed compressors and ECM blower motors, improved humidity control, quieter operation, and smart system integrations can elevate comfort significantly.
Ask for an airflow and duct assessment during any air conditioning replacement quote. You could be losing 10–30% of cooled air to leaks or poor duct design—fixing that boosts comfort and lowers bills.
Furnace Repair vs. Furnace Replacement: Safety, Savings, and Peace of Mind
The stakes are higher with heating due to combustion safety.
Choose furnace repair when:
The furnace is under 12–15 years old and the issue involves an ignitor, flame sensor, pressure switch, or minor control board fix.
Combustion analysis confirms safe operation and heat exchanger integrity.
Consider furnace replacement when:
The heat exchanger is cracked or compromised. Safety first—replacement is non-negotiable in this case.
The furnace is 15–20 years old and major parts are failing.
You’re upgrading to a high-efficiency system (e.g., 95%+ AFUE) with sealed combustion for safety and cost savings.

HVAC Installation Done Right: The Four Pillars of Quality
Quality HVAC installation is far more than “hook it up and go.” It sets the tone for decades.
Right sizing
Load calculations account for square footage, insulation, windows, orientation, infiltration, and occupant patterns.
Airflow and duct design
Proper static pressure, duct sizing, sealed joints, and balanced supply/return minimize noise and maximize comfort.
Commissioning and verification
Refrigerant charge validation, airflow measurement, temperature splits, and smart thermostat calibration ensure peak performance.
Documentation and education
Model/serial numbers, settings, maintenance intervals, and homeowner orientation.
A well-executed HVAC installation can outperform a superior brand installed poorly. Prioritize the contractor’s process and proof of results.
Indoor Air Quality in Roseville: Pollen, Dust, and Smoke Strategy
Our region’s air quality can swing fast, particularly during wildfire season. Your HVAC system is a frontline defense.
Filtration upgrades
MERV 11–13 filters capture fine particles; check system compatibility to avoid airflow restriction.
Sealed ducts
Prevent unfiltered attic or crawlspace air from entering living spaces; duct sealing can drastically improve IAQ and efficiency.
Fresh air strategies
ERVs/HRVs can balance ventilation while protecting energy efficiency, especially in tighter homes.
Portable vs. whole-home purification
Portable HEPA units are useful for specific rooms; whole-home options can integrate with existing ductwork.
Humidity management
While Roseville is generally dry, humidity spikes do happen. A variable-speed system and adequate ventilation help stabilize indoor comfort.
If smoke is in the forecast, pre-cool your home, set systems to recirculate, and ensure filters are fresh to maintain indoor air quality.

DIY Troubleshooting: Safe, Simple Checks Before You Call
Before you schedule an air conditioning repair service, try these low-risk steps:
Check the thermostat
Correct mode, temperature setpoint, fresh batteries if needed, and “fan auto” setting.
Inspect the air filter
Replace if dirty; note the install date and set a reminder for next change.
Examine the breaker panel
AC and furnace breakers should be on; reset once if tripped.
Confirm outdoor unit clearance
Remove leaves and debris, ensure 18–24 inches of space around the condenser.
Clear the condensate drain
If safe, use a wet/dry vac on the drain line outside to remove clogs; look for a float switch tripping.
Look and listen
Icing on lines? Unusual vibration? Shut off and call a pro if you see frost or hear grinding.
If the system still misbehaves, it’s time for professional HVAC repair. Don’t open sealed panels or handle refrigerants—those require licensed service.
What Does HVAC Maintenance Include? A Detailed Checklist
A robust maintenance visit should include:
Cooling season tune-up
Clean condenser and evaporator coils.
Measure refrigerant charge via superheat/subcooling.
Test capacitor, contactor, relays, and fan motors.
Inspect and flush condensate drain; treat for algae if needed.
Check duct static pressure and temperature split.
Verify thermostat calibration and sensor placement.
Heating season tune-up
Clean burners and flame sensor; verify ignition sequence.
Inspect heat exchanger where accessible.
Test inducer motor and pressure switch operation.
Verify gas pressure, combustion, and venting.
Measure temperature rise within manufacturer specs.
Check blower wheel cleanliness and belt condition (if applicable).
Year-round items
Inspect electrical connections and tighten lugs.
Evaluate ductwork condition and insulation.
Replace or recommend filters.
Document findings with photos and readings.

How to Read Your HVAC System’s Vital Signs: Simple Metrics That Matter
Temperature split (cooling)
Supply air should be roughly 16–22°F cooler than return under normal conditions.
Temperature rise (heating)
Follow the furnace nameplate range; common is 30–60°F. Too high can indicate airflow issues.
Static pressure
Excessive pressure strains the blower and reduces efficiency; duct improvements or filter changes may be needed.
Amp draws and voltage
Technicians use these to diagnose failing components before they quit.
Consistent measurements over time help predict failures and schedule proactive repairs.

Maintenance Myths, Debunked
Myth: “If it’s cooling, it’s fine.”
Reality: Small inefficiencies accumulate. Dirty coils, weak capacitors, and low refrigerant degrade performance and shorten lifespan.
Myth: “Higher MERV is always better.”
Reality: Not if your system can’t handle the resistance. Match filtration to your blower capability.
Myth: “Bigger systems cool faster and better.”
Reality: Oversized systems short cycle, waste energy, and do a poor job managing humidity and comfort.
Myth: “Closing vents saves money.”
Reality: It can increase static pressure, strain the blower, and cause duct leaks.
Good maintenance is about balance and system design, not quick hacks.

The Ultimate Guide to HVAC Repair in Roseville, CA: Quick Reference Tables
Efficiency Ratings Overview | System | Key Rating | Typical Modern Range | What It Means | |---|---|---|---| | Air Conditioner | SEER2 | 14–22+ | Cooling efficiency over a season | | Heat Pump | HSPF2 | 7.5–10+ | Heating efficiency for heat pumps | | Furnace | AFUE | 80–98% | Percentage of fuel converted to heat |
Filter Options at a Glance | Filter Type | MERV | Pros | Considerations | |---|---|---|---| | Pleated | 8 | Good baseline, affordable | Change every 1–3 months | | Pleated | 11–13 | Better for pollen/smoke | Check static pressure limits | | HEPA (whole-home) | 16 | Highest capture rate | Requires compatible housing |
Common Repair Clues | Symptom | Likely Cause | First Step | |---|---|---| | Warm air from vents | Low refrigerant, dirty coil | Replace filter, call for service | | Furnace clicks but no heat | Dirty flame sensor | Schedule cleaning | | High energy bill | Duct leaks, old unit | Request energy assessment | | Water near indoor unit | Clogged drain | Clear condensate line |
